#3f5916 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f5916 is composed of 24.7% red, 34.9%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.3%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 83.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 21.8%. #3f5916 color hex could be obtained by blending #7eb22c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#3f5916 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f5916 has RGB values of R:63, G:89,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 4151574.

Shades and Tints of #3f5916
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a03 is the darkest color, while #fcf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f5916
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#383b34 is the less saturated color, while #446e01 is the most saturated one.
